Bhopal: The issue of a geography textbook claiming that word ‘Gond’ meant cow slaughterer and beef eater rocked the state Assembly on Wednesday. The book is prescribed by a few colleges for post graduate students. Following the ruckus, the state government declared that author of the book Harish Khatri would be blacklisted.

Raising the issue during the Question Hour, Leader of Opposition Ajay Singh said that an MA-Geography textbook titled ‘Bharat Ka Bhoogol’ describes Gonds as beef eaters.

A geography textbook prescribed for postgraduate students in a few colleges says that word ‘Gond’ means cow slaughterer and beef eater. The issue The Congress created a ruckus in the House on the issue on Wednesday. The government announced that writer of the book Harish Khatri would be blacklisted.

Describing Gonds as a respected community, Singh said that such a mention in the book was an insult to them. He demanded that the chief minister make a statement on the issue. Following this, the Congress members rushed into the Well of the House and raised anti-government slogans forcing the Speaker to adjourn the House twice for 10 minutes each. Amidst the mayhem, the legislative business listed for the day was transacted and the House was adjourned till Thursday.

Singh said that a probe should be conducted to ascertain as to how such a book was prescribed in the curriculum and demanded that persons concerned should be punished. Replying to the debate, higher education minister Jaibhan Singh Pawaiya said that Mahakaushal College, Jabalpur, principal had prescribed the book in curriculum. The minister said that a show cause notice was served on the principal as soon as the issue came to government’s notice. He also accused the Congress of politicising the issue.
